The Honourable Joanne Thompson, Minister of Fisheries, will participate in a key international mission to promote Canadian seafood in European markets, beginning April 20, 2026. While in Barcelona, the Minister will lead the Canadian delegation at Seafood Expo Global (SEG) 2026, showcasing Canada’s high-quality fish and seafood products, advance trade diversification, and strengthen commercial and government partnerships across the world.
